Cast iron has been used for many centuries for a variety of goods,
toys, industrial pieces,
kitchenware and many more. Some of the earliest evidence of iron goes back as far as 3500 BC in Egypt. Cast iron is one of the most common metals on earth, well-known for its durability and its ability to retain heat. It has to some extent been supplanted by alloys to enhance its durability.
